Essential Care Guidelines for Shelby Plants
Light Needs
Shelby Plants thrive in bright, indirect light, similar to conditions under a tree canopy. An east or north-facing window usually provides suitable illumination. Too much direct sunlight can scorch foliage, causing faded or brown spots. Insufficient light often leads to elongated stems and sparse leaves as the plant stretches for more light.
Watering Practices
Proper watering is crucial for Shelby Plants. Allow the top inch or two of soil to dry out before watering again; assess this by inserting a finger. When watering, thoroughly drench the soil until water drains from the pot’s bottom, ensuring the entire root ball receives moisture. Both over and underwatering can cause significant stress and visible symptoms.
Soil and Container Choice
Shelby Plants thrive in a well-draining potting mix that retains some moisture. A suitable blend includes peat moss, perlite, and pine bark, providing aeration and drainage while holding nutrients. A container with drainage holes is essential to prevent waterlogging. The pot size should be proportionate to the plant’s root ball; a pot that is too large can hold excess moisture, increasing overwatering risk.
Temperature and Humidity Considerations
Maintaining appropriate temperature and humidity levels helps Shelby Plants flourish. They prefer indoor temperatures between 60°F and 85°F (15-29°C) during the day, with slightly cooler temperatures at night (ideally 10-15°F lower). Moderate to high humidity, ideally 40% to 60%, is beneficial. Increase ambient humidity by grouping plants, using a pebble tray, or employing a room humidifier, especially in dry environments.
Nutrient Supply
Shelby Plants require a consistent nutrient supply. Fertilize during their active growing season (spring and summer) every 2 to 4 weeks. A balanced liquid fertilizer, diluted to half or quarter strength, prevents over-fertilization, which can cause root burn or weak growth. During fall and winter, when growth slows, reduce or cease fertilization.
Propagating and Repotting Shelby Plants
Propagation Methods
Propagating Shelby Plants creates new plants from existing ones, often through asexual methods. Stem cuttings are a common technique. To propagate, select a healthy, non-flowering stem and make a clean cut a few inches below a node, ensuring the cutting has at least two to four leaves. Remove any lower leaves that would be submerged, then place the cutting in water or a well-draining potting mix. Rooting hormone can encourage faster root development, and consistent moisture and warmth should be maintained until new roots emerge, typically within weeks.
Division is another straightforward method, particularly for Shelby Plants that produce multiple growth points or clumps. Carefully remove the plant from its pot and gently separate the root ball into smaller sections, each with its own roots and foliage. Ensure each division has healthy roots to support new growth. Pot these newly divided plants into their own containers with fresh soil for independent establishment.
When and How to Repot
Shelby Plants typically need repotting every one to three years, depending on growth rate. Signs include roots emerging from drainage holes, stunted growth, water draining quickly, or the plant appearing top-heavy. The best time for repotting is late winter or early spring, before the active growing season.
Choose a new container one to two inches larger in diameter than the previous one, or larger than the plant’s root ball. Carefully remove the plant from its current pot, gently loosen any circling roots, and trim damaged or rotting sections. Place a layer of fresh, well-draining potting mix at the new pot’s bottom, center the plant, and backfill with more soil, ensuring the plant is at the same depth. Water thoroughly after repotting to settle the soil and reduce transplant shock.
Identifying and Solving Common Shelby Plant Issues
Leaf Discoloration and Other Visual Cues
Leaf discoloration in Shelby Plants often signals an underlying issue.
Yellowing leaves, especially older ones, can indicate overwatering, nutrient deficiencies, or insufficient light. If accompanied by soft, mushy stems or a foul odor, overwatering and root rot are likely.
Brown tips or edges often point to underwatering, low humidity, or salt buildup from tap water or fertilizer.
Scorched brown spots suggest too much direct sunlight.
Crispy leaves, stunted growth, or soil pulling away from the pot’s edge suggest underwatering.
Adjusting watering, evaluating light, or flushing soil can help resolve these issues.
Growth Habits and Legginess Concerns
Shelby Plants can develop leggy growth, characterized by long, stretched stems with sparse leaves. This occurs when the plant lacks sufficient light, causing it to stretch for more energy. Inconsistent watering, over-fertilization, or lack of pruning can also contribute. To address this, move the plant to a brighter location or supplement with artificial grow lights. Pruning elongated stems encourages bushier, more compact growth.
Pest and Disease Management
Shelby Plants can encounter common houseplant pests.
Spider mites cause tiny brownish or reddish speckling and fine webbing.
Mealybugs appear as cottony masses.
Aphids are small, pear-shaped insects found on new growth.
Regular inspection aids early detection. Treat infestations by wiping pests with rubbing alcohol, spraying insecticidal soap, or applying neem oil.
Fungal diseases like powdery mildew, root rot, or leaf spots can also affect plants.
Powdery mildew appears as white, powdery patches on leaves.
Root rot causes mushy, discolored roots and wilting foliage (often linked to overwatering).
Leaf spots manifest as brown or black spots.
These issues are often linked to poor air circulation or high humidity. Improve air circulation, ensure proper drainage, and avoid overwatering as preventative measures. Remove affected plant parts; in severe cases, use a targeted fungicide.
